The Computer Science Club has Private Enterprise Number 27934. Our corresponding OID arc is 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.

  • .iso.org.dod.internet.private.enterprises.csclub
  • .iso(1).org(3).dod(6).internet(1).private(4).enterprises(1).csclub(27934)

We use custom OID's for a few purposes, which are listed below:

  •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.1: LDAP attributes
    • 1.3.6.1.4.1.1466.115.121.1.1: user attribute arc
      •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.1.1.1: term attribute
      •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.1.1.2: program attribute
      •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.1.1.3: studentid attribute [no longer used]
    •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.1.2: user type arc
      •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.1.2.1: member attribute
      •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.1.2.2: club attribute
  •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.2: Net-SNMP extensions
    •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.2.1: postfix statistics
      •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.2.1: postfix bounced count
      •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.2.2: postfix received count
      •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.2.3: postfix rejected count
      •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.2.4: postfix sent count
      •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.2.5: postfix spam count
      • 1.3.6.1.4.1.27934.2.6: postfix virus count
